How It Works: Simple as an Email
1. Snap a Photo
Take a straight-on photo of your wall with your phone.
Tip: Don't worry about clearing the space! If you are looking to refresh, just leave whatever is currently hanging. Seeing your existing decor helps us ensure the new piece fits the room's energy perfectly.
2. Send It Over
Email your photo to info@CoastalFineArtPrints.com. In your email, please include:
The name of the print(s) you would like to see.
The approximate width of the wall (so we can ensure perfect scaling).
3. Receive Your Custom PDF (Sample on Left)
We will thoughtfully style the artwork into your photo and email you a personalized PDF mockup, showing you exactly how the scale, colors, and presence of the art will live in your home.

The Colors You Live With Matter
We spend a great deal of time thinking about how our homes look. But perhaps an even more important question is: How does your home make you feel? Color is part of our everyday environment. It surrounds us when we wake up, when we gather with people we love, and when we return home at the end of the day. The colors we choose can help create spaces that feel joyful, peaceful, energetic, welcoming, or restorative. A few things to think about when choosing the colors you live with: Color can influence the mood of a room.Soft blues may create a feeling of calm and openness. Turquoise and aqua can feel refreshing and uplifting. Warm colors can bring energy, comfort, and a sense of welcome. Your surroundings become part of your everyday experience.We see the walls, objects, and artwork in our homes thousands of times. Choosing colors that make you feel good can add small moments of pleasure to ordinary days. Color can bring life to a quiet space.A room does not need to be filled with color to feel vibrant. Sometimes one beautiful piece of art can completely change the energy of a space. The colors you love are personal.Trends come and go. The colors that make you stop, smile, remember, or feel something belong to you. Nature offers some of the best inspiration.The blues of the ocean. The turquoise of shallow water. The warmth of sunlight. The unexpected colors of a sunset. Nature reminds us that beautiful colors were never meant to be timid. Art can change how a room feels without changing everything else.You do not always need new furniture, new paint, or an entirely new room. The right artwork can bring movement, personality, and emotion into the space you already have. Living with art is different from simply looking at it.The artwork you choose becomes part of the rhythm of your life. You pass it in the morning. You notice it from across the room. Over time, it becomes part of the feeling of home. Perhaps the most important question when choosing color or art isn't: “Does this match my room?” Maybe it is: “How do I want to feel when I walk into this room?” Calm. Joyful. Energized. Peaceful. Inspired. There is no single right answer. Only the feeling you want to live with. Choose the Feeling You Want to Live With.
